- 博客(13)
- 资源 (1)
- 收藏
- 关注
原创 JavaScript函数一
JavaScript函数 函数(function)是一段可执行的JS代码,其具备以下特征 :–由JS预定义或用户自定义–函数可以被定义多次,也可以被调用多次–函数可以带有多个形式参数或实际参数–函数最多可以返回一个值–Javascript函数的名称是一个变量名称,其数据类型是function–函数是一个函数对象–函数内部还可以嵌套函数三种定义方法– 函数关键字(function)语句:① function myFuncA(){alert(‘哈哈A’);}– 函数字
2020-09-08 08:13:36 116
原创 转发与重定向的区别
1. 转发携带数据地址栏不变;服务器内部跳转,浏览器不知道公用一个request,所以可以在request作用域中存储数据A接到用户请求,帮助用户找到B只能跳转到当前项目下代码实现:req.getRequestDispatcher(URI).forward(req, resp);2. 重定向地址栏改变浏览器发送新的请求不共享一个requestA接到用户的请求,告诉用户,你去找B可以到跳转到其它项目下可以到跳转到其它项目下3. request 转发设置数据到reque
2020-09-08 08:12:41 193
原创 JavaScript 流程控制语句
JavaScript流程控制语句流程控制: 控制程序的执行顺序顺序结构.分支结构(条件结构或选择结构)循环结构If分支结构可以称if 语句,根据表达式的布尔值进行分支选择。 <script> var a = 60; var b = 20; var c = 30; var d = 40; //多向条件语句 if (a > b) { console.log
2020-07-24 09:35:49 114
原创 JavaScript 运算符二
JavaScript运算符赋值运算符算符说明例子=x=yx=y+=x+=yx=x+y-=x-=yx=x-y*=x*=yx=x*y/=x/=yx=x/y%=x%=yx=x%y比较运算符算符说明例子==等于,注意和赋值运算符“=”区分开5 == 8 返回false 5 == ‘5’ 返回true===全等于,要求值、类型都相等5===‘5’ 返回false!=
2020-07-22 11:46:28 168 1
原创 JavaScript 类型转换
JavaScript类型转换隐式转换介绍:在js中,当运算符在运算时,如果两边数据不统一,CPU就无法计算,这时我们编译器会自动将运算符两边的数据做一个数据类型转换,转成一样的数据类型再计算这种无需程序员手动转换,而由编译器自动转换的方式就称为隐式转换例如1 > "0"这行代码在js中并不会报错,编译器在运算符时会先把右边的"0"转成数字0`然后在比较大小隐式转换规则:转成string类型: +(字符串连接符)转成number类型:++/–(自增自减运算符) + - * /
2020-07-22 11:06:13 189
原创 JavaScript数据类型
JavaScript数据类型(值类型和引用类型对比)javascript中变量类型分为值类型(基本数据类型)和引用类型值类型: String(字符串),Number(数值),Boolean(布尔值),Undefined,Null引用类型: Array(数组),object(对象),Function(函数)值类型和引用类型的区别存储位置不一样值类型:栈内存引用类型:把变量名储存在栈内存, 而变量的值存储在堆内存里面 var a = 10; var b = 20;
2020-07-16 10:34:20 98
原创 JavaScript 运算符一
算数运算符±*/ % <script> console.log(2 + 2);//4 console.log(2 - 6);//-4 console.log(2 * 3);//6 console.log(2 / 5);//0.4 console.log(0.1 + 0.2); console.log(1 % 20); // 1 console.log(24 % 5); // 4 </script>+号两边任
2020-05-20 18:17:01 106
原创 SpringMVC执行流程(入门)
SpringMVC执行流程(入门)springMVC的流程图具体步骤:第一步:发起请求到前端控制器(DispatcherServlet)第二步:前端控制器请求HandlerMapping查找 Handler (可以根据xml配置、注解进行查找)第三步:处理器映射器HandlerMapping向前端控制器返回Handler,HandlerMapping会把请求映射为Han...
2020-05-08 17:00:38 161
原创 初识Spring-AOP
初识Spring-AOP什么是AOPSpring-AOP是一种动态编译期增强性AOP的实现, 与IOC进行整合,不是全面的切面框架 与动态代理相辅相成AOP(Aspect-oriented programming)是面向切面的编程。Spring框架中一个重要内容可与提高代码的灵活性和可拓展性函数式编程的一种衍生范型,利用AOP可以对业务逻辑的各个部分进行隔离目标类 + 额外功能 =...
2020-04-22 23:16:06 151
原创 初识JavaScript
初识JavaScript一、JS组成ECMAScript:基础语法DOM:对象是文档BOM:对象是浏览器二、JS代码写入位置HTML中body标签中如:<body> <script> alert("hello world!") </script></body>HTML中head标签中如:...
2020-04-20 09:35:01 179
原创 CSS中元素的两种居中方式
水平居中对于行内元素: text-align: center;对于确定宽度的块级元素:width和margin实现。margin: 0 auto;绝对定位和margin-left: -width/2, 前提是父元素position: relative;对于宽度未知的块级元素table标签配合margin左右auto实现水平居中。使用table标签(或直接将块级元素设值为d...
2020-04-14 18:54:40 184
原创 CSS基础标签
CSS基础标签列表自定义列表dldtdd序列表ul无序列表ulli有序列表olli权重优先级!important 权重无限大行内样式,权重1000ID选择器单个权重100类名选择器,属性选择器,伪类选择器,单个权重10标签选择器,伪元素选择器,单个权重1统配符选择器,关系选择器(+,>,~,""),否定伪类,权重0...
2020-04-14 18:50:01 229
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人